Description

The Graphocephala atropunctata, commonly known as the blue-green sharpshooter, is an insect pest belonging to the order Hemiptera and the family Cicadellidae. This species is primarily recognized for its role in damaging viticulture and its ability to act as a significant vector for various plant pathogens.

These pests primarily target grapevines, although they are known to feed on a wide variety of ornamental plants, shrubs, and native trees. Because they are highly mobile, they can quickly infest large areas of commercial vineyards, making management a critical part of agricultural maintenance in affected regions.

The life cycle of this sharpshooter typically involves several generations per year. Females deposit eggs into the leaf petioles or soft stems of the host plant. The damage caused by Graphocephala atropunctata is twofold. Direct feeding causes foliage chlorosis and can stunt plant growth. More critically, the insect is a known carrier of the bacterium Xylella fastidiosa, which is the pathogen responsible for Pierce's disease in grapevines, a condition that blocks the plant's water-conducting vessels and eventually kills the vine.

Effective management strategies should include the following approaches:

  • Monitoring adult populations with yellow sticky cards.
  • Removing weeds and host plants surrounding the vineyard to disrupt the life cycle.
  • Applying systemic insecticides specifically during the peak nymph emergence periods.
  • Implementing biological controls where suitable and maintaining vineyard health to minimize susceptibility.
